[发明专利]一种基于云服务平台进行相等性测试的结构化加密方法及系统有效
申请号: | 201910208122.2 | 申请日: | 2019-03-19 |
公开(公告)号: | CN109902501B | 公开(公告)日: | 2021-09-17 |
发明(设计)人: | 曲海鹏;颜祯;林喜军;徐建良 | 申请(专利权)人: | 中国海洋大学 |
主分类号: | G06F21/60 | 分类号: | G06F21/60;H04L9/08;H04L29/08 |
代理公司: | 北京工信联合知识产权代理有限公司 11266 | 代理人: | 姜丽楼 |
地址: | 266100 山*** | 国省代码: | 山东;37 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开一种基于云服务平台进行相等性测试的结构化加密方法及系统,方法为:系统初始化,生成系统参数,将系统参数公开;用户根据系统参数生成自身密钥,包括公钥和私钥;消息发送者利用系统参数和目标用户的公钥对结构化消息进行结构化加密,生成结构化消息的密文,将密文上传至云服务器;当需要对密文中某个字段的值同其它用户密文中相应字段的值做相等性测试时,用户利用自身的私钥对密文中待测试的字段进行结构化授权,生成对密文中该字段的授权陷门,将授权陷门上传至云服务器;云服务器收到来自不同用户的密文和授权陷门后,在不恢复明文信息的前提下,根据不同用户的授权陷门,提取用户密文中待测试的字段所对应的消息进行相等性测试。 | ||
搜索关键词: | 一种 基于 服务 平台 进行 相等 测试 结构 加密 方法 系统 | ||
【主权项】:
1.一种基于云服务平台进行相等性测试的结构化加密方法,所述方法包括:系统初始化,生成系统参数,并将所述系统参数公开;用户根据所述系统参数生成自身密钥,所述密钥包括公钥和私钥;消息发送者利用所述系统参数和目标用户的公钥对结构化消息进行结构化加密,生成结构化消息的密文,将所述密文上传至云服务器;当需要对所述密文中某个字段的值同其它用户密文中相应字段的值做相等性测试时,用户利用自身的私钥对所述密文中待测试的字段进行结构化授权,生成对密文中该字段的授权陷门,将所述授权陷门上传至云服务器;云服务器收到来自不同用户的密文和授权陷门后,在不恢复明文信息的前提下,根据不同用户的所述授权陷门,提取用户密文中待测试的字段所对应的消息进行相等性测试。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国海洋大学,未经中国海洋大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201910208122.2/,转载请声明来源钻瓜专利网。